* [Comm] пересылка почты только в пределах своего домена
@ 2003-03-28 10:49 Mike Lykov
2003-03-28 15:44 ` Dmitry Lebkov
0 siblings, 1 reply; 2+ messages in thread
From: Mike Lykov @ 2003-03-28 10:49 UTC (permalink / raw)
To: community
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Хелло всем!
вот вопрос такой возник:
есть почтовый сервер (sendmail 8.11.6), который обслуживает некоторый домен.
возникла необходимость завести несколько пользователей, для которых должна
быть доступна только локальная доставка в пределах этого домена.
т.е. при попытке таким узером послать почту вовне этого домена - запрещение.
что-то ничего в голову не идет. может, кто скажет - как?
- --
Mike
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.3.1 (GNU/Linux)
iD8DBQE+hCjI581JXpJ05OERApC5AJ4tFJrhpslpvxjDFPxB0TJiwK2SqACfSlIn
8bBv5cLy1zDfceK1vfyLczM=
=sPvX
-----END PGP SIGNATURE-----
^ permalink raw reply [flat|nested] 2+ messages in thread
* Re: [Comm] пересылка почты только в пределах своего домена
2003-03-28 10:49 [Comm] пересылка почты только в пределах своего домена Mike Lykov
@ 2003-03-28 15:44 ` Dmitry Lebkov
0 siblings, 0 replies; 2+ messages in thread
From: Dmitry Lebkov @ 2003-03-28 15:44 UTC (permalink / raw)
To: community
On Fri, 28 Mar 2003 14:49:44 +0400
Mike Lykov <combr@vesna.ru> wrote:
>
> Хелло всем!
>
> вот вопрос такой возник:
>
> есть почтовый сервер (sendmail 8.11.6), который обслуживает некоторый
> домен. возникла необходимость завести несколько пользователей, для
> которых должна быть доступна только локальная доставка в пределах
> этого домена.
>
> т.е. при попытке таким узером послать почту вовне этого домена -
> запрещение.
Путей много. Вот примерный сценарий одного из. Сделать map (назовем его
restricted), содержащий:
user1@your.domain.tld LOCAL
user2@your.domain.tld LOCAL
Определить новый класс (обзовем ldomains), содержащий домены, на которые
можно отправлять почту "урезанным" юзерам (или можно тоже все это в map
засунуть):
your.domain.tld OK
domain2.tld OK
и дописать в набор Local_check_rcpt необходимые правила, проверяющие
наличие 'MAIL FROM:' в restricted и наличие доменной части 'MAIL FROM'
в ldomains. Что-то типа:
R$* $: <$&{mail_addr}>
R<$+ @ $*> $: <$(restricted $1@$2 $: ? $)> <$(ldomains $2 $: ?)>
R<LOCAL><?> $#error $@ 5.7.1 $: "550 Relaing denied"
R<LOCAL><OK> $@ OK
R<$*><$*> $@ OK
> что-то ничего в голову не идет. может, кто скажет - как?
Или проблема, именно в написании правил?
--
WBR, Dmitry Lebkov
^ permalink raw reply [flat|nested] 2+ messages in thread
end of thread, other threads:[~2003-03-28 15:44 UTC | newest]
Thread overview: 2+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2003-03-28 10:49 [Comm] пересылка почты только в пределах своего домена Mike Lykov
2003-03-28 15:44 ` Dmitry Lebkov
ALT Linux Community general discussions
This inbox may be cloned and mirrored by anyone:
git clone --mirror http://lore.altlinux.org/community/0 community/git/0.git
# If you have public-inbox 1.1+ installed, you may
# initialize and index your mirror using the following commands:
public-inbox-init -V2 community community/ http://lore.altlinux.org/community \
mandrake-russian@linuxteam.iplabs.ru community@lists.altlinux.org community@lists.altlinux.ru community@lists.altlinux.com
public-inbox-index community
Example config snippet for mirrors.
Newsgroup available over NNTP:
nntp://lore.altlinux.org/org.altlinux.lists.community
AGPL code for this site: git clone https://public-inbox.org/public-inbox.git